Safety notes for normal operation, control

Personal injury, physical damage and downtimes due to improper operation.
Operators of the DLT-V4108 must be trained in the handling of the device.
Risk of accident! Personal injury and physical damage caused by using the terminal and
driving at the same time.
Do not operate the DLT-V4108 terminal while driving.
Risk of injury and physical damage due to improper deployment location (refueling
stations, etc.)
Observe the intended use of the DLT-V4108, e.g. not in potentially explosive areas, not in
life-supporting facilities.
Turn off the DLT-V4108 when you are near gas stations, fuel depots, chemical plants or
places where blasting operations take place.
Ensure that the deployment location of the DLT-V4108 complies with the permissible
environmental conditions.
Observe the specific IP protection class.
NOTICE: Physical damage
Overvoltage on the DLT-V4108 when charging the vehicle battery.
While the vehicle battery is charging:
− The DLT-V4108 must be disconnected from the vehicle battery.
− Or it must be ensured that the maximum permitted input voltage of the DLT-V4108 is not
exceeded.
